Telephone wiring is thin, meaning it is easily routable but also easily damaged. Because of this, do not run wires nor install jacks: • Near any source of heat, such as water pipes and air ducts, which can corrode the wiring.

WebRJ12/RJ25 and RJ45 jacks are for multiline telephone networks and data networks. Plates with a 110 punch-down wire connection are quicker to install than jacks with a screw or spade terminal. They require a punch-down tool (sold separately). Plates with a phone bracket connect and hold the telephone on a wall. Telephone.
